Interpreting Results Effectively

The results page presents several key data points. Focus first on the ISP field—this tells you who provides the connection. Next, check the connection type: 'hosting' suggests a server, 'residential' indicates a home user, 'mobile' means cellular data. The location data shows country, region, and city with confidence levels. I always pay attention to the timezone field—it's surprisingly useful for scheduling maintenance or understanding user activity patterns.

Contextual Analysis Method

Never analyze an IP address in isolation. Cross-reference lookup results with other data: server log timestamps, user agent strings, and behavioral patterns. An IP from a hosting provider might be normal for API access but suspicious for user account creation. I maintain a database of known-good IP ranges for regular users and partners to reduce false positives.

Accuracy Assessment Techniques

Geolocation accuracy varies. Urban areas typically show city-level precision, while rural locations might only reach regional accuracy. I verify questionable results using multiple data points—if an IP shows as German ISP but the timezone is UTC-8, something is likely wrong. The tool's confidence indicators help gauge reliability.

Common Questions & Answers

Based on helping hundreds of users, here are the most frequent questions with detailed answers.

How accurate is the geolocation data?

Accuracy depends on the ISP and region. Major ISPs in developed countries typically provide city-level accuracy (within 5-10km). Mobile IPs might show the location of the carrier's network center rather than the actual device. The tool indicates confidence levels—trust city-level data for fixed connections but be cautious with mobile or satellite connections.

Can you track someone's exact address with this tool?

Absolutely not. Privacy protections prevent pinpoint accuracy. The tool shows general location (city/region) but never exact addresses. This is both a technical limitation and a privacy feature—ISPs don't share precise customer location data with geolocation services.

Why does my IP show a different city than where I am?

Several factors cause this. Your ISP might route traffic through a different regional hub. VPN or proxy usage obviously changes apparent location. Mobile networks often show the location of the nearest tower rather than your exact position. Business networks might use centralized gateways in different cities.

How often is the IP database updated?

The underlying databases update continuously as ISPs allocate new IP ranges and network configurations change. Major changes propagate within days, but complete global updates take longer. For the most current data, our tool aggregates multiple reputable sources.

Does it work with IPv6 addresses?

Yes, the tool fully supports IPv6 lookups. However, geolocation accuracy for IPv6 can vary as adoption patterns differ globally. The tool provides available data for any valid IPv6 address.

Industry Trends & Future Outlook

The IP lookup landscape is evolving rapidly, driven by privacy concerns and technological changes.

Privacy Regulations Impact

GDPR and similar regulations are making IP addresses increasingly considered personal data. This affects how lookup services operate and what data they can provide. Future tools will likely offer more privacy-preserving approaches while still providing useful context for legitimate use cases.

IPv6 Adoption Challenges

As IPv6 adoption grows, geolocation faces new challenges. The vast address space and different allocation patterns require updated methodologies. Tools that effectively handle IPv6 geolocation will have a significant advantage in coming years.

Integration with Threat Intelligence

The future lies in combining IP lookup with real-time threat intelligence. Instead of just showing location, tools will indicate if an IP is currently involved in attacks, part of botnets, or otherwise malicious. This contextual enrichment transforms passive data into active defense information.
